Chapter and section headings contained herein shall not be deemed to govern, limit, <br />modify or in any manner affect the scope, meaning or intent of any section hereof. <br /> <br />H. Unless the context clearly indicates the contrary: <br /> <br />1. The present tense includes the future, and the future the present. <br /> <br />2. The singular number includes the plural, and the plural the singular. <br /> <br />3. References in the masculine and feminine genders are interchangeable. <br /> <br />4. The words “activities” and “facilities” include any part thereof. (Ord. 2001-015 § 1) <br /> <br />1.12.108 Definitions <br /> <br />Abate. To bring into conformity with the provisions of this Code, either by reconstruction or <br />modification pursuant to a valid permit, or by removal or obliteration as directed by the Chief <br />Building Official or Zoning Enforcement Official. <br /> <br />Abutting or Adjoining. Having district boundaries or lot lines in common. <br /> <br />Accessory Dwelling Unit (ADU). “Accessory dwelling unit” (ADU) means aAn attached or <br />detached residential dwelling unit which provides complete independent living facilities for <br />one or more persons. An ADUs shall include permanent provisions for living, sleeping, eat- <br />ing, cooking, and sanitation on the same parcel as the single-family dwelling is situated. An <br />ADU also includes: (a) an efficiency unit, as defined in Section 17958.1 of the California <br />Health and Safety Code; and or a (b) a manufactured home, as defined in Section 18007 <br />and 17958.1 of the California Health and Safety Code. ADUs are regulated by See also <br />Section 2.04.388 Accessory Dwelling Units (ADUs). <br /> <br />A. Accessory Dwelling Unit, Repurposed (Single-Family). An attached or detached <br />ADU within an existing legally established (a) single-family dwelling, or (b) existing <br />accessory structure on a parcel with an existing or proposed single-family dwelling. <br />B. Accessory Dwelling Unit, Repurposed (Two-Family or Multi-Family). An at- <br />tached ADU within existing non-habitable space(s) including, but not limited to, stor- <br />age rooms, boiler rooms, passageways, attics, basements, or attached garages in an <br />existing legally established two-family or multi-family structure. <br />C. Junior Accessory Dwelling Unit (JADU). A unit that is contained within the habita- <br />ble floor area of a single-family residence and includes a separate exterior entrance. <br />A JADU may include separate sanitation facilities, or may share sanitation facilities <br />with the existing structure. At minimum, a JADU shall include an efficiency kitchen, <br />which shall include a food preparation counter, refrigerator, and storage cabinets. <br /> <br /> <br />City Council Hearing March 2, 2020 280
